Market Surveillance Authority

To fulfill the tasks of the Accessibility Reinforcement Act, the federal states of Germany are currently establishing a joint authority. The Market Surveillance Authority for Accessibility of Products and Services (MLBF) is scheduled to begin operation as a new public-law institution on 28 June 2025, based in Magdeburg, Saxony-Anhalt. This is subject to ratification of the state treaty on the implementation of the BFSG by all federal states. Preparatory steps are currently underway in all states.
